Contextual Understanding : How AI is Learning to Understand the Nuances of Communication

Artificial intelligence (AI) has made significant strides in recent years, demonstrating an growing ability to process and understand vast amounts of data. However, a key challenge for AI remains the skill to truly comprehend the subtleties of human communication. Context plays a crucial role in this regard, as it provides the structure for interpreting meaning and intent.

AI models are now being trained on comprehensive datasets that include verbal communications, allowing them to learn the patterns that govern how language is used in different scenarios. This improved understanding of context empowers AI to produce more human-like responses, process complex conversations, and even detect sarcasm, humor, and other sentimental cues.

Human Intuition vs. AI Logic: Navigating the Complexities of Contextual Awareness

In the realm of artificial intelligence, a compelling discussion surfaces concerning the effectiveness of human intuition versus algorithmic reasoning. While AI excels at processing vast datasets of data and identifying patterns, it often fails to understand the subtleties of contextual awareness. Human intuition, on the other hand, anchors itself on accumulated experience and a complex understanding of human cues. Ultimately, the challenge lies in leveraging the strengths of both approaches to achieve a more holistic form of decision-making.
